Hyper-V MAC地址管理技巧揭秘
hyper-v mac

首页 2024-11-28 18:11:11



Hyper-V MAC 地址管理:解锁虚拟化潜能的关键 在当今高度信息化的时代,虚拟化技术已成为企业IT架构中不可或缺的一部分

    它不仅能够显著提高资源利用率,降低成本,还能增强系统的灵活性和可扩展性

    而在众多虚拟化解决方案中,微软的Hyper-V凭借其出色的性能、与Windows操作系统的深度集成以及强大的管理功能,赢得了广泛的认可

    然而,要充分发挥Hyper-V的潜力,一个关键却常被忽视的细节便是MAC地址的管理

    本文将深入探讨Hyper-V MAC地址管理的重要性、挑战、最佳实践以及如何通过有效管理来提升虚拟化环境的效率和安全性

     一、Hyper-V MAC地址管理的重要性 MAC地址(Media Access Control Address)是网络世界中设备的唯一标识符,它决定了数据包在网络中的传输路径

    在虚拟化环境中,每个虚拟机(VM)都需要一个独立的MAC地址来与其他设备进行通信

    Hyper-V作为虚拟化平台,负责为这些虚拟机分配和管理MAC地址

     1.网络通信的基础:正确的MAC地址分配是虚拟机接入网络、实现内外通信的前提

    错误的MAC地址配置可能导致网络通信故障,影响业务连续性

     2.资源隔离与安全性:在Hyper-V环境中,合理的MAC地址规划有助于实现虚拟机之间的网络隔离,减少安全风险

    通过为不同安全级别的虚拟机分配不同范围的MAC地址,可以更容易地实施访问控制和流量监控

     3.动态迁移与扩展:随着业务需求的增长,虚拟机可能需要在不同的物理主机间进行动态迁移

    良好的MAC地址管理策略能够确保迁移过程中网络连接的连续性,支持无缝扩展

     二、Hyper-V MAC地址管理的挑战 尽管Hyper-V提供了基本的MAC地址分配机制,但在实际操作中,管理者仍面临诸多挑战: 1.手动分配的繁琐:在大型虚拟化环境中,手动为每个虚拟机分配MAC地址不仅耗时费力,还容易出错,尤其是在快速部署大量虚拟机时

     2.地址冲突与耗尽:缺乏有效的MAC地址管理机制,可能会导致地址冲突,影响网络通信

    同时,随着虚拟机数量的增加,MAC地址资源也可能迅速耗尽

     3.动态迁移的复杂性:在虚拟机迁移过程中,如果MAC地址管理不当,可能会导致网络配置丢失或更改,影响服务的可用性和性能

     4.合规性与审计:许多行业对网络配置有严格的合规要求,包括MAC地址的使用

    缺乏透明度和可追溯性的MAC地址管理,可能使企业在合规审计中面临风险

     三、Hyper-V MAC地址管理的最佳实践 针对上述挑战,以下是一些Hyper-V MAC地址管理的最佳实践,旨在帮助管理员优化流程,提升效率,确保安全: 1.自动化分配与管理: - 利用Hyper-V的虚拟交换机和动态MAC地址池功能,实现MAC地址的自动分配

    这不仅可以减少手动操作的错误,还能提高资源分配的效率

     - 考虑采用第三方虚拟化管理工具,这些工具通常提供更高级别的MAC地址管理功能,如地址预留、批量分配等,进一步简化管理过程

     2.规划合理的地址空间: - 根据业务需求和虚拟机数量,提前规划MAC地址空间,确保有足够的地址资源可供分配

     - 采用层次化的地址规划策略,如基于部门、项目或安全级别的划分,便于管理和审计

     3.实施动态迁移策略: - 确保Hyper-V集群中的所有物理主机都配置了相同的虚拟交换机设置,包括MAC地址池的配置,以便在虚拟机迁移时保持网络配置的一致性

     - 利用Hyper-V的Live Migration功能,实现虚拟机在不中断服务的情况下进行迁移,同时保持网络连接的连续性

     4.监控与审计: - 部署网络监控工具,实时监控MAC地址的使用情况,及时发现并解决地址冲突、耗尽等问题

     - 定期进行MAC地址管理的合规性审计,确保所有配置符合行业标准和内部政策

     5.强化安全策略: - 通过设置网络访问控制(NAC)策略,限制虚拟机之间的网络通信,基于MAC地址进行访问控制,增强安全性

     - 定期更换关键虚拟机的MAC地址,作为一种额外的安全措施,防止潜在的攻击者利用固定的MAC地址进行追踪或攻击

     四、结论 Hyper-V MAC地址管理虽